Handover note — Crumbwheel order cutoffs.

Welcome aboard. The bakery cutoff rule in Crumbwheel closes same-day orders at 14:00 local to each storefront, not UTC — this has bitten us twice. Holiday overrides live in the calendar service and take precedence silently, so always check there first when a cutoff looks wrong. To unlock the calendar service's admin console after a restart, enter the recovery passphrase below.

vault phrase of bagap-bahaf = silion-pelox-sorox-casdor-quenwyn-fraax-eliox-praael-kelion-quenvan-kasox-rusael-norius-belvan

## Runbook — Config Hot-Reload on Brightrail

Brightrail services watch the config channel and apply changes without restart. After pushing a change, confirm the `config_version` metric increments on every node within two minutes. If a node lags, check that it can reach the config registry database using the connection string below.

primary connection of yagep-kahip = redis://giliel_svc:zYiKsLL2PLpfPL@db-348f.xolmarsys.corp:5432/fenwyn

/*
 * Client initialization for Tariffix, the rules engine that
 * computes shipping fees per region and carrier tier.
 * Rules are cached for five minutes; flush via /rules/refresh
 * if a fee change isn't showing. On auth failures, verify the
 * internal Tariffix gateway key defined below.
 */

app token of bawep-hafog = kto7_vwrmnlx

# Door Sensor Recall — Halcrest Building

Vendor Threnmark has recalled the VX-series door sensors fitted on floors 2 and 5. Units may fail open. Engineers swap them out this week; affected doors run in manual mode until done. Prop nothing open. Check the swap log each morning. For manual override on those doors, enter the code below.

staff pass of kawip-hawef = bdg-QLP-2